Transaction 15252976543d6433ecdf137920cb9b3ebea80118b91c2360e9a9a26f1f4e7d09
1 Input
1 Output
-
15252976543d6433ecdf137920cb9b3ebea80118b91c2360e9a9a26f1f4e7d09:0
- value
- 572063
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ebbfa19a95c7688aee6fe5bf401852cf3cba937e OP_EQUAL
- address
- 3PBYHQ1rBFXaLsgodGcvUifmwiBiDGVVBq